Understanding Cooker Hood Carbon Filters
Cooker hood carbon filters are designed to trap and neutralize odors from cooking fumes. They work through a process called adsorption, where odor molecules adhere to the porous surface of activated carbon. This activated carbon, typically made from materials like coconut shells or wood, is treated to create an extensive internal surface area, maximizing its ability to absorb odors.
Types of Carbon Filters
Several types of carbon filters exist, each with varying effectiveness and lifespan.
-
Granular Activated Carbon (GAC) Filters: These filters contain loose granules of activated carbon. They are generally less expensive but may not be as effective as other types.
-
Impregnated Carbon Filters: These filters have activated carbon treated with chemicals to enhance their ability to capture specific odors.
-
Honeycomb Carbon Filters: These filters have a honeycomb structure, providing a larger surface area for adsorption and improved airflow.

Factors Influencing Carbon Filter Replacement Frequency
The lifespan of a cooker hood carbon filter is not fixed. Several factors determine how often you need to replace it. Recognizing these influences will help you maintain optimal air quality and extend the life of your cooker hood.
Cooking Frequency and Style
The more frequently you cook, and the more pungent your cooking style, the more often you’ll need to replace your carbon filter. If you regularly prepare meals with strong aromas, such as frying, grilling, or using spices like garlic and onions, your filter will become saturated more quickly. Heavy cooking necessitates more frequent replacements.
Type of Food Cooked
Certain foods produce more odors and grease than others. Foods high in fat, such as bacon or fried foods, release significant amounts of grease that can clog the filter. Similarly, dishes with strong spices or pungent ingredients will saturate the carbon filter more rapidly.
Cooker Hood Usage
If you consistently use your cooker hood while cooking, it will be more effective at capturing odors and grease. However, this also means the carbon filter will be working harder and will require more frequent replacement.
Filter Quality
The quality of the carbon filter itself plays a significant role in its lifespan. Higher-quality filters with a greater amount of activated carbon will generally last longer and perform better than cheaper alternatives. Investing in a good quality filter is more economical in the long run.
Manufacturer Recommendations
Always refer to your cooker hood’s user manual for the manufacturer’s recommendations on carbon filter replacement. These recommendations are based on the specific design and performance characteristics of your hood. Adhering to these guidelines will ensure optimal performance and prevent damage.
Signs Your Carbon Filter Needs Replacing
Knowing when to replace your carbon filter isn’t always obvious. Here are some telltale signs that indicate it’s time for a change.
Persistent Cooking Odors
This is the most obvious sign. If you notice that cooking odors are lingering in your kitchen even after using your cooker hood, it’s a clear indication that the carbon filter is saturated and no longer effectively absorbing odors.
Reduced Airflow
A clogged carbon filter restricts airflow, making your cooker hood less efficient at removing smoke and grease. If you notice a decrease in suction power, check the filter.
Visible Grease Buildup
If you can see grease buildup on the surface of the carbon filter, it’s definitely time to replace it. Grease buildup reduces the filter’s ability to absorb odors and can also pose a fire hazard.
Unpleasant Smells Emanating from the Hood
Sometimes, a saturated carbon filter can start to emit unpleasant smells, even when you’re not cooking. This is a sign that the trapped odors are starting to decompose and release back into the air.
The General Rule: Replacement Frequency
While the factors mentioned above influence the ideal replacement frequency, a general guideline can be followed.
Typical Replacement Intervals
As a general rule, replace your cooker hood carbon filter every 3 to 6 months. For heavy cooking households, a replacement every 3 months might be necessary. For lighter cooking, every 6 months may suffice.
Considerations for Recirculating Hoods
If you have a recirculating cooker hood (one that doesn’t vent outside), the carbon filter is even more crucial. These hoods rely solely on the carbon filter to purify the air before recirculating it back into the kitchen. Therefore, more frequent replacement is generally recommended.
How to Replace Your Cooker Hood Carbon Filter
Replacing a carbon filter is a straightforward process. Always consult your cooker hood’s user manual for specific instructions.
Safety First
Before starting, disconnect the cooker hood from the power supply to prevent electrical shock.
Locating the Filter
The carbon filter is typically located behind the grease filter. Remove the grease filter to access the carbon filter.
Removing the Old Filter
Depending on the model, the carbon filter may be held in place by clips, screws, or a retaining ring. Carefully remove the old filter, noting its orientation for proper installation of the new filter.
Installing the New Filter
Insert the new carbon filter in the same orientation as the old one. Secure it with the clips, screws, or retaining ring.
Replacing the Grease Filter
Reinstall the grease filter. Ensure it is securely in place.
Testing the Hood
Reconnect the cooker hood to the power supply and test it to ensure it is working properly.

Cleaning vs. Replacing: Is Cleaning an Option?
While some sources suggest cleaning carbon filters, it’s generally not recommended.
Why Cleaning is Not Ideal
Activated carbon filters work by adsorption, where odor molecules adhere to the carbon surface. Cleaning can remove some surface debris, but it cannot restore the filter’s ability to adsorb odors. Washing can also damage the activated carbon, reducing its effectiveness.
The Best Practice
The most effective way to maintain air quality is to replace the carbon filter regularly. Cleaning is a temporary and ultimately ineffective solution. Replacing ensures that the filter is functioning optimally and providing the best possible odor removal.
Extending the Life of Your Carbon Filter
While regular replacement is essential, you can take steps to extend the lifespan of your carbon filter.
Clean Your Grease Filters Regularly
Grease filters trap grease and prevent it from reaching the carbon filter. Cleaning them regularly (usually every 1-2 months) will help keep the carbon filter cleaner and more effective.
Use Your Cooker Hood Properly
Turn on your cooker hood before you start cooking and leave it on for a few minutes after you finish to effectively remove odors and grease.
Avoid Overloading the Filter
If you’re cooking something particularly pungent, consider opening a window to help ventilate the kitchen and reduce the load on the carbon filter.

Can I wash or regenerate my cooker hood carbon filter instead of replacing it?
Some carbon filters are designed as disposable, single-use items and cannot be washed or regenerated. Attempting to clean these types of filters will damage their structure and significantly reduce their effectiveness. Check your cooker hood’s user manual to determine if your filter is specifically designated as non-washable before attempting any cleaning methods. Attempting to wash a non-washable filter will likely render it unusable.
While some manufacturers offer “regenerable” carbon filters that can be reactivated through heating, these are less common. The reactivation process typically involves baking the filter in an oven at a specific temperature to burn off accumulated grease and odors. However, even regenerable filters have a limited lifespan and will eventually require replacement after several reactivation cycles. Always follow the manufacturer’s instructions precisely when regenerating a carbon filter to avoid damage or reduced performance.

Are there different types of carbon filters, and do they affect performance?
Yes, there are various types of carbon filters available, and their material and construction can influence their performance. Some filters utilize activated carbon granules, while others incorporate activated carbon cloth or foam. Activated carbon is highly porous, allowing it to effectively trap odors and grease particles. The density and quality of the activated carbon directly impact its absorption capacity and lifespan.
Furthermore, some filters may include additional layers or coatings designed to enhance their effectiveness. For example, some filters have a pre-filter layer to capture larger particles before they reach the carbon layer, extending its lifespan. Others may incorporate specialized coatings to target specific odors. Choosing a higher-quality carbon filter, even if it’s slightly more expensive, can result in better odor absorption, longer lifespan, and improved overall cooker hood performance.
